Unveiling the iPhone 16 Series: What Indian Consumers Need to Know

The highly anticipated iPhone 16 series has made its debut for pre-orders in India, igniting excitement among tech enthusiasts and Apple aficionados alike. With four distinct models—the iPhone 16, iPhone 16 Plus, iPhone 16 Pro, and iPhone 16 Pro Max—buyers are eager to reserve their devices ahead of their official launch on September 20. This article aims to unpack the key features, pricing, and promotions surrounding the latest offerings from Apple, while also examining how they stack up against previous models.

A Comprehensive Look at the Models and Prices

The iPhone 16 series has generated considerable buzz due to its innovative features and striking design. The entry-level model, iPhone 16, starts at ₹79,900 for its 128GB version, making it a premium choice in the market. For consumers who desire a larger display and better battery life, the iPhone 16 Plus starts at ₹89,900, also featuring 128GB of storage. Subsequently, the two high-end models, the iPhone 16 Pro and iPhone 16 Pro Max, begin at ₹1,19,900 and ₹1,44,900 respectively, with the Pro Max boasting a generous 256GB storage option.

Customers in India will find several color options available for the iPhone 16 series. The standard models come in a lively palette of Black, Pink, Teal, Ultramarine, and White, appealing to a broad aesthetic range. In contrast, the Pro models feature a more subdued yet sophisticated palette of Black Titanium, Desert Titanium, Natural Titanium, and White Titanium. This suggests that Apple is aiming to cater to both the youthful demographic and the more mature professional market.

Enhancements in Technology and Features

One notable highlight of the iPhone 16 series is the presence of Apple Intelligence, a powerful software feature designed to enhance user experience. However, it is important to note that localized support for this feature in India is projected to be rolled out next year, leaving customers eager for full functionality to wait a bit longer. To help mitigate the financial impact of purchasing these high-end devices, Apple has announced enticing promotional offers. Customers can avail up to ₹5,000 off when paying with select credit cards from American Express, Axis Bank, and ICICI Bank. Furthermore, Apple provides substantial exchange incentives, with potential discounts of up to ₹67,500 if customers trade in their old smartphones. The offerings do not stop there; both three-month and six-month no-cost EMI options add additional accessibility for buyers who may not wish to pay the full amount upfront.

Meanwhile, several third-party retailers are also jumping in with their own enticing deals, amplifying the competition in the market. Entities like Aptronix, iVenus, and iFuture are offering cashback promotions, adding further financial appeal to the purchase of the iPhone 16 series. Their exchanges mirroring Apple’s—though with varying amounts—showcase how consumers can maximize their savings when transitioning to a new device.
